Exploration Place Offers Free GSK Science in the Summer Program

June 10, 2021

WICHITA, Kansas — Exploration Place has partnered with the Franklin Institute in Philadelphia to offer the free GSK Science in the Summer™ program. The 2021 theme is Be An Engineer!

Exploration Place educators will visit schools, libraries and community centers across the region with the aim of inspiring the next generation of scientists and engineers. Children in grades 2 – 6 will explore science careers, think scientifically and practice real science techniques.

In Be An Engineer!, students will tackle electrical, biomedical, environmental and structural engineering challenges through experiments, videos and live virtual events. They will explore the engineering design process as they find solutions to real-world problems, from managing a playground’s stormwater runoff to designing a sturdy lightweight pedestrian bridge.

“Scientists are finding solutions to problems today we never thought we would face, so it’s even more important now to foster students’ interest in science early so they can see themselves as future scientists,” said Becki Lynch, Director, US Community Partnerships at GSK.

Exploration Place, the largest science center in the state, has seen extraordinary growth in demand for its STEM education programming in recent years.

“We believe strongly in our role to help strengthen the STEM workforce pipeline for future generations,” said Adam Smith, Exploration Place president. “Exploration Place is proud of this effort to remove barriers so that all children can take advantage of their natural curiosity in a fun and encouraging environment.”
